1、客戶端與服務器之間的通信模型 基於Socket連接的客戶端與服務器之間的通信模型圖如上圖所示,整個通信過程如下所示: (1) 服務器端首先啟動監聽程序,對指定的端口進行監聽,等待接收客戶端的連接請求; (2)客戶端程序啟動,請求連接服務器的指定端口; (3)服務器收到客戶端的連接 ...
網絡應用編程模型 目錄 網絡應用編程模型 互聯網與企業內部網 網絡的兩個含義: C S模式和B S模式 早期計算機網絡的通信模型 分散式 Decentralized 分散式系統 優點 缺點 集中式 Centralized 集中式系統 優點 缺點 分布式 Distributed 分布式系統 分布式系統與計算機網絡的區別 C S模式 特點 C S應用程序編程模型 B S模式 優點 缺點 B S編程模型 ...
2020-03-03 18:01 0 1135 推薦指數:
1、客戶端與服務器之間的通信模型 基於Socket連接的客戶端與服務器之間的通信模型圖如上圖所示,整個通信過程如下所示: (1) 服務器端首先啟動監聽程序,對指定的端口進行監聽,等待接收客戶端的連接請求; (2)客戶端程序啟動,請求連接服務器的指定端口; (3)服務器收到客戶端的連接 ...
K8S網絡模型 解決容器在集群之間的互通。 K8S設計了網絡模型,但卻將它的實現交給了網絡插件,CNI網絡插件最主要的功能就是實現POD資源能夠跨宿主機進行通信。 常見的CNI網絡插件 Flannel(重點):依賴於etcd去存儲網絡信息的 Calico:網絡限制,網絡規則的內容 ...
一、網絡模型概述 k8s的網絡中主要存在四種類型的通信:同一pod內的容器間通信、各pod彼此之間的通信、pod與service間的通信、以及集群外部的流量同service之間的通信。 k8s為pod和service資源對象分別使用了各自的專用網絡,pod網絡由k8s的網絡插件配置實現 ...
前兩章分別講了Socket的數據傳輸,本章開始將在前兩章的基礎上構建一個消息傳輸機制. 因為服務端和客戶端都離不開消息的傳輸,所以先講如何在前兩章的基礎上構建消息傳輸的信道,本例構造了一個類MessageSession,該類負責消息在網絡中傳送,並且該類實現了一個接口 ...
Black-Scholes 期權定價模型概述 1997年10月10日,第二十九屆諾貝爾經濟學獎授予了兩位美國學者,哈佛商學院教授羅伯特·默頓(RoBert Merton)和斯坦福大學教授邁倫·斯克爾斯(Myron Scholes)。他們創立和發展的布萊克——斯克爾斯期權定價模型(Black ...
今天研究了一下k8s的網絡模型,該解析基於flannel vxlan+ kubeproxy iptables 模式。 一.Docker 首先分析一下Docker層面的網絡模型,我們知道容器是基於內核的namespace機制去實現資源的隔離的。network是眾多namespace中的一個 ...
網絡棧 一個進程發起和響應網絡環境(網絡棧) 網卡 回環設備 路由表 iptables規則 kubernetes-cni包 在宿主機上安裝CNI插件所需要的基礎可執行文件(/opt/cni/bin) flannel項目對應的cni ...
在k8s中,我們的應用會以pod的形式被調度到各個node節點上,在設計集群如何處理容器之間的網絡時是一個不小的挑戰,今天我們會從pod(應用)通信來展開關於k8s網絡的討論。 小作文包含如下內容: k8s網絡模型與實現方案 pod內容器通信 pod與pod通信 pod ...